Go to the control panel > program and features > scroll down the list and find NVIDIA > then select NVIDIA and click uninstall. It will ask if you want to restart the system.. click yes
Press F8 on startup and go into windows in safe mode.
Run driver cleaner and select NVIDIA drivers.. then clean.
Go to the control panel > system> device manager > graphics card. Right click on any present and click uninstall
Restart the system and go into windows normally. Install the NVIDIA drivers listed above which you put into a temporary folder
Restart the system.. and fingers crossed all should be well! -

Just installed this one and did a quick Resident evil 5 benchmark on my G50VT in my signature, not so hot compared to DOX'S 195.62:
RE5 settings:1920x1080, all high/shadow low/AA off, all effect on
DX9 variable benchmark:
Official 197.16: average 35.7 FPS
dox's 195.62: average 38.9 FPS
3FPS may not seem a lot to you, but to me it matters a lot when FPS is under 40. Dox's 195.62 still works the best for me so far, beats all the Nvidia drivers. -
